diff options
author | Brad Bishop <bradleyb@fuzziesquirrel.com> | 2017-01-26 11:26:04 -0500 |
---|---|---|
committer | Patrick Williams <patrick@stwcx.xyz> | 2017-02-14 16:28:47 +0000 |
commit | 44ee749d75848f0babb6ceb225c34c8fa2dd381a (patch) | |
tree | 2d255c45688b062adda7640ad2515c7df569254f /meta-openbmc-machines/meta-openpower | |
parent | 4f12f72793d2fecd7403d4c2aa117af6c40d7f9b (diff) | |
download | talos-openbmc-44ee749d75848f0babb6ceb225c34c8fa2dd381a.tar.gz talos-openbmc-44ee749d75848f0babb6ceb225c34c8fa2dd381a.zip |
Clean up op packagegroups
Now that the legacy applications are picked up in the OpenPOWER layer
via obmc-apps packagegroups, those dependencies can be removed
from the op-apps packagegroup.
Remove the sensord application as it has been replaced with
phosphor-hwmon.
Demote sensor mgmt feature to an image feature since anything
running OpenBMC can have a sensor.
Change-Id: I0b27cacbcbd73d53ab8db40790ea967ad478d111
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Diffstat (limited to 'meta-openbmc-machines/meta-openpower')
-rw-r--r-- | meta-openbmc-machines/meta-openpower/common/recipes-phosphor/packagegroups/packagegroup-op-apps.bb | 11 | ||||
-rw-r--r-- | meta-openbmc-machines/meta-openpower/conf/machine/include/openpower.inc | 2 |
2 files changed, 0 insertions, 13 deletions
diff --git a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/packagegroups/packagegroup-op-apps.bb b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/packagegroups/packagegroup-op-apps.bb index 0b5f6d896..ba8a95023 100644 --- a/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/packagegroups/packagegroup-op-apps.bb +++ b/meta-openbmc-machines/meta-openpower/common/recipes-phosphor/packagegroups/packagegroup-op-apps.bb @@ -6,42 +6,31 @@ inherit obmc-phosphor-license PROVIDES = "${PACKAGES}" PACKAGES = " \ - ${PN}-sensors \ ${PN}-chassis \ ${PN}-fans \ ${PN}-flash \ ${PN}-system \ " -PROVIDES += "virtual/obmc-sensor-mgmt" PROVIDES += "virtual/obmc-chassis-mgmt" PROVIDES += "virtual/obmc-fan-mgmt" PROVIDES += "virtual/obmc-flash-mgmt" PROVIDES += "virtual/obmc-system-mgmt" -RPROVIDES_${PN}-sensors += "virtual-obmc-sensor-mgmt" RPROVIDES_${PN}-chassis += "virtual-obmc-chassis-mgmt" RPROVIDES_${PN}-fans += "virtual-obmc-fan-mgmt" RPROVIDES_${PN}-flash += "virtual-obmc-flash-mgmt" RPROVIDES_${PN}-system += "virtual-obmc-system-mgmt" -SUMMARY_${PN}-sensors = "OpenPOWER Sensors" -RDEPENDS_${PN}-sensors = " \ - obmc-hwmon \ - obmc-mgr-sensor \ - " - SUMMARY_${PN}-chassis = "OpenPOWER Chassis" RDEPENDS_${PN}-chassis = " \ obmc-button-power \ obmc-button-reset \ obmc-control-chassis \ obmc-hostcheckstop \ - obmc-mgr-inventory \ obmc-op-control-power \ obmc-pcie-detect \ obmc-watchdog \ - obmc-control-led \ " SUMMARY_${PN}-fans = "OpenPOWER Fans" diff --git a/meta-openbmc-machines/meta-openpower/conf/machine/include/openpower.inc b/meta-openbmc-machines/meta-openpower/conf/machine/include/openpower.inc index dd90dcc91..e29a91fa6 100644 --- a/meta-openbmc-machines/meta-openpower/conf/machine/include/openpower.inc +++ b/meta-openbmc-machines/meta-openpower/conf/machine/include/openpower.inc @@ -1,7 +1,6 @@ OBMC_MACHINE_FEATURES += "\ obmc-phosphor-fan-mgmt \ obmc-phosphor-chassis-mgmt \ - obmc-phosphor-sensor-mgmt \ obmc-phosphor-flash-mgmt \ obmc-host-ipmi \ obmc-host-ctl \ @@ -17,7 +16,6 @@ PREFERRED_PROVIDER_virtual/obmc-host-ipmi-hw = "phosphor-ipmi-bt" PREFERRED_PROVIDER_virtual/obmc-chassis-mgmt = "packagegroup-op-apps" PREFERRED_PROVIDER_virtual/obmc-fan-mgmt = "packagegroup-op-apps" PREFERRED_PROVIDER_virtual/obmc-flash-mgmt = "packagegroup-op-apps" -PREFERRED_PROVIDER_virtual/obmc-sensor-mgmt = "packagegroup-op-apps" PREFERRED_PROVIDER_virtual/obmc-system-mgmt = "packagegroup-op-apps" PREFERRED_PROVIDER_virtual/obmc-host-ctl ?= "obmc-op-control-host" PREFERRED_PROVIDER_virtual/obmc-inventory-data ?= "${VIRTUAL-RUNTIME_skeleton_workbook}" |